Neglect
Form of abuse
Neglect ▸ Facts ▸ Comments ▸ News ▸ Videos
In the context of caregiving, neglect is a form of abuse where the perpetrator, who is responsible for caring for someone who is unable to care for themselves, fails to do so. It can be a result of carelessness, indifference, or unwillingness and abuse.
